Does the university recognize "other equivalent language certificates"? no information provided by university
Additional information:
English language proficiency can also be proven by ICFE – International Certificate in Financial English, ILEC – International Legal English Certificate, an English-language school-leaving certificate, a previous degree in English (at least 180 ECTS credits), or English-language study achievements and examinations amounting to at least 20 ECTS credits or equivalent achievements of equivalent scope.
Applicants whose language of origin is English can also demonstrate compliance with the language level by submitting official documents showing that the applicant learns the language in early childhood without formal instruction as a first language and spent at least eight of first twelve years of his/her life in a country in which the relevant language is used as the official language.

The application deadline for the M.Sc. Optical Scienсеs at Humboldt-Universität zu Berlin depends on the country where you obtained your previous degree. For applicants with a degree from non-EU countries, the application deadline is 28 June for the winter semester and 15 January for the summer semester. Applications are made: Directly at university, Uni-assist (VPD).

Application Documents
Please note that an application cannot be considered unless uni-assist has received all the required documentation within the prescribed period.
The following documents must be attached to an application:
Officially authenticated copies of educational certificates obtained so far, including the secondary school leaving certificate together with marks received and, if applicable, university entrance examination documentation, evidence of study areas and grades obtained in previous studies including an explanation of the given grading system, graduation certificate and, if applicable, diploma supplement.
Enrolment certificate, if you are a student at another German or European higher education institution at the time you apply for a place at Humboldt, or certificate of exmatriculation (Exmatrikulationsbescheinigung) specifying the areas of study and number of semesters if you have previously studied at another higher education institution in Germany.
German translations of all certificates (exception: documents in English) as officially authenticated copies.
Evidence of German language skills (see language requirements) and/or English, French, Spanish proof, etc. as officially authenticated copies - if applicable for the chosen subject.
CV starting with the beginning of school education up till now.
A photocopy of your passport or identity card (for applicants from the EU).
The self-assessment sheet is required for some Masters (available as a pdf file on the uni-assist application portal). For every master, the entry and language requirements have to be taken into accοunt.
